"κέρμα" meaning in Ancient Greek

See κέρμα in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/kér.ma/, /ˈcer.ma/, /ˈcer.ma/, /kér.ma/ (note: 5ᵗʰ BCE Attic), /ˈker.ma/ (note: 1ˢᵗ CE Egyptian), /ˈcer.ma/ (note: 4ᵗʰ CE Koine), /ˈcer.ma/ (note: 10ᵗʰ CE Byzantine), /ˈcer.ma/ (note: 15ᵗʰ CE Constantinopolitan)
Etymology: From κείρω (keírō, “to cut short, shear, clip”) + -μα (-ma).
